Our FNH 655E has the four speed with shuttle shift and the shuttle shift has quit working completely. We replaced the whole shuttle shift and that was not the issue. It was periodically blowing a fuse that controlled the shuttle and a higher amp fuse was put in place. Well the fuse did not blow this time but something else did. Anyway we fried something along the way? Any help? I can find very little online about this. Or anyway to jump it into gear. Just trying to get it to move so we can get it to the sale as we bought a new back hoe. This one has been a headache my whole life. Just trying to see it make it to the sale yard!

BTW, what size fuse did you put in after the original blew? Original should be 5A IIRC. And in a pinch you can just run 12VDC to the shift solenoids, they'll engage, but a little harsher than usual. Normal engagement is phased in gradually over a few seconds' time. If you just apply 12V it will be an instant shift. As long as the machine is idling it won't hurt anything, and will get you moving.
